Ok, but do your testing on the fuse box sockets, not the fuse blades or those test slots on top. This way you will not be overlooking a problem that is right under your nose. After you have established continuity through the fuse box you can then use those test slots on the fuses for future tests. What you need, is power on the fuse exit side socket -- before you can move on (assuming you need to). Let us know what you find in that fuse box.

Default Check your electrical grounds!

I have been vexed by many electrical gremlins until I changed my old, corroded ground connections out with new cables. Without good engine and chassis grounds, your volts and amps find interesting paths back to the battery, sometimes affecting your relays that control devices that normally have no discernable system connection to each other.
